After three years of silence, the U.S. and Russia have resumed high-level talks, with Presidents Trump and Putin discussing major economic partnerships.
Key topics include American investments in Russia's rare-earth sector and billion-dollar trade deals.
The talks, held in Riyadh, have excluded Ukraine and the EU, sparking outrage among European leaders.
Both sides claim the negotiations are a crucial step toward normalization, while the White House faces criticism for sidelining its allies.

Russian President Vladimir Putin is set to visit China for the high-stakes SCO Summit, marking his longest foreign trip since 2014. The summit highlights Moscow and Beijing’s growing partnership amid rising global tensions and U.S. tariff disputes. With trade between the two powers hitting $245 billion in 2024, China has become Russia’s top partner. Alongside political messaging, both nations aim to deepen economic and military cooperation. The SCO, joined by India and Brazil, is emerging as a counterweight to U.S.-led global dominance.

Russian President Vladimir Putin has declared that Moscow continues scientific cooperation with Western experts despite heavy sanctions and political isolation. Speaking in Sarov, Russia’s nuclear hub, Putin insisted that science, like art and sports, cannot be destroyed by politics. He revealed that joint projects persist in nuclear, space, and medical research, even with some NATO states, while new ventures in nuclear medicine are emerging. According to Putin, Russia lost Finland as a partner but continues work with France, Germany, and Hungary through Rosatom. He stressed that Russia still supplies nuclear fuel and services to “unfriendly” countries, hinting that departing partners may eventually return. Putin also warned the West that restricting academic and scientific ties will inflict long-term damage. Despite sanctions, Russia and the U.S. recently extended collaboration on the International Space Station and discussed future lunar and deep-space missions.
